Chapter Five: The Spell is Broken

272 Words
Elias returned to the clearing by the pond, where the full moon cast its silver light over the land. He stood at the water's edge, holding the crystal and the flower, and called out to Luna. "Luna, my love! I have completed the trials. I am ready to break the spell." The water of the pond shimmered, and Luna appeared, her gown of moonbeams glowing with an otherworldly light. She stepped onto the shore, her eyes filled with hope and love. "Elias," she whispered, her voice trembling. "You have done it. You have proven your love and your worth." Elias approached her, holding out the crystal and the flower. "What must I do to break the spell?" he asked. Luna took the crystal and the flower from his hands and held them close to her heart. "With these symbols of your courage, resolve, and love, I will break the spell that binds me." She closed her eyes and began to chant, her voice rising and falling like a song. The air around them seemed to shimmer, and a soft, golden light enveloped Luna. The light grew brighter and brighter, until it filled the entire clearing. Elias watched in awe as the spell began to unravel, the ancient magic that had bound Luna for so long dissolving in the light of their love. Finally, the light faded, and Luna stood before him, free and radiant. She smiled, tears of joy streaming down her cheeks. "The spell is broken," she said. "I am free." Elias took her hands in his, his heart overflowing with love and happiness. "We did it, Luna. We are free."
